On 01/10/2015 12:28, Paolo Bonzini wrote:
> The format of the role word has changed through the years and the
> plugin was never updated; some VMX exit reasons were missing too.
>
> Signed-off-by: Paolo Bonzini <pbonzini@redhat.com>
> ---
> tools/lib/traceevent/plugin_kvm.c | 25 +++++++++++++++++--------
> 1 file changed, 17 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/tools/lib/traceevent/plugin_kvm.c b/tools/lib/traceevent/plugin_kvm.c
> index 88fe83dff7cd..18536f756577 100644
> --- a/tools/lib/traceevent/plugin_kvm.c
> +++ b/tools/lib/traceevent/plugin_kvm.c
> @@ -124,7 +124,10 @@ static const char *disassemble(unsigned char *insn, int len, uint64_t rip,
> _ER(WBINVD, 54) \
> _ER(XSETBV, 55) \
> _ER(APIC_WRITE, 56) \
> - _ER(INVPCID, 58)
> + _ER(INVPCID, 58) \
> + _ER(PML_FULL, 62) \
> + _ER(XSAVES, 63) \
> + _ER(XRSTORS, 64)
>
> #define SVM_EXIT_REASONS \
> _ER(EXIT_READ_CR0, 0x000) \
> @@ -352,15 +355,18 @@ static int kvm_nested_vmexit_handler(struct trace_seq *s, struct pevent_record *
> union kvm_mmu_page_role {
> unsigned word;
> struct {
> - unsigned glevels:4;
> unsigned level:4;
> + unsigned cr4_pae:1;
> unsigned quadrant:2;
> - unsigned pad_for_nice_hex_output:6;
> unsigned direct:1;
> unsigned access:3;
> unsigned invalid:1;
> - unsigned cr4_pge:1;
> unsigned nxe:1;
> + unsigned cr0_wp:1;
> + unsigned smep_and_not_wp:1;
> + unsigned smap_and_not_wp:1;
> + unsigned pad_for_nice_hex_output:8;
> + unsigned smm:8;
> };
> };
>
> @@ -385,15 +391,18 @@ static int kvm_mmu_print_role(struct trace_seq *s, struct pevent_record *record,
> if (pevent_is_file_bigendian(event->pevent) ==
> pevent_is_host_bigendian(event->pevent)) {
>
> - trace_seq_printf(s, "%u/%u q%u%s %s%s %spge %snxe",
> + trace_seq_printf(s, "%u q%u%s %s%s %spae %snxe %swp%s%s%s",
> role.level,
> - role.glevels,
> role.quadrant,
> role.direct ? " direct" : "",
> access_str[role.access],
> role.invalid ? " invalid" : "",
> - role.cr4_pge ? "" : "!",
> - role.nxe ? "" : "!");
> + role.cr4_pae ? "" : "!",
> + role.nxe ? "" : "!",
> + role.cr0_wp ? "" : "!",
> + role.smep_and_not_wp ? " smep" : "",
> + role.smap_and_not_wp ? " smap" : "",
> + role.smm ? " smm" : "");
> } else
> trace_seq_printf(s, "WORD: %08x", role.word);
>
